    Appreciate the chart. May be a stretch, but the reason I’m asking is because I just recently retrofitted a RAV4 steering wheel. It has controls on both the left and right side. The left side of the steering wheel is illuminating, but the right side is not. I’m wondering what I will have to do to get the right side to illuminate. It’s the same plug, just slightly different wire colors and locations. As you can see from the attachment, the right side controls has 3 wires coming out of it. The White/Black & Pink go to the connector and the yellow one goes into the left side controls and attaches to the board. I’m wondering what from the right side plug I will need to connect/re-connect to get it to illuminate as well.

    Here is a picture of the steering wheel. The only buttons that illuminate are the two large white buttons on both sides. “Mode” on left and “Display” on right. The left side is identical to the Tacoma controls and everything works & illuminates as it should. The right side “Display” won’t function when pushed since Tacoma didn’t have this option which I’m okay with, but I’d still like for it to illuminate if possible. So I’m trying to figure out what I need to hook up for it to get some power. This steering wheel is plug and play for everything on the left side, but from the earlier photos of the both the Tacoma and RAV4 plugs you can see the colors differ at some of the locations and obviously the RAV4 has the additional wire coming from the right side since it has this display button.

    That is all. The left side already illuminates and buttons work properly. All I want is the right side display button to illuminate. here is a slightly better picture of the connector. 10 pin. From left to right:

    Top: Red,Black/White,Blank, Blank, Blue(Horn)
    Bottom: Brown, Grey, White, Pink, Blank
    (Yellow doesn’t go into connector, it runs from left switch board to right.)
